解题思路:先用数组装,然后排好序后,装入set,然后输出就好了
注意事项:
参考代码:
#include<bits/stdc++.h> using namespace std; int main() { int x[10000]; set <int> s; int n; cin>>n; for(int i=0;i<n;i++) { cin>>x[i]; } sort(x,x+n); for(int i=0;i<n;i++) { s.insert(x[i]); } cout<<s.size()<<endl; set<int>::iterator it; for(it=s.begin();it!=s.end();it++) { cout<<*it<<' '; } return 0; }
0.0分
1 人评分
C语言程序设计教程(第三版)课后习题7.2 (C语言代码)浏览:662 |
C语言程序设计教程(第三版)课后习题6.6 (C++代码)浏览:633 |
C语言程序设计教程(第三版)课后习题8.7 (C语言代码)浏览:916 |
最小公倍数 (C语言代码)浏览:1029 |
1024题解浏览:811 |
核桃的数量 (C语言代码)浏览:872 |
2006年春浙江省计算机等级考试二级C 编程题(2) (C语言代码)浏览:345 |
C语言程序设计教程(第三版)课后习题11.3 (C语言代码)浏览:2166 |
2003年秋浙江省计算机等级考试二级C 编程题(1) (C语言代码)浏览:817 |
求圆的面积 (C语言代码)浏览:658 |